数控编程属于什么大学

数控编程属于什么大学

数控编程通常属于机械工程与自动化专业、电子工程专业以及计算机科学与技术专业。在机械工程与自动化领域,数控编程是生产过程中不可或缺的一环,它依赖于精密的工程设计和工艺规划,以确保零件加工的精确性和效率。该学科要求学生不仅要掌握机械设计的基础知识,还需要熟悉最新的数控技术和编程方法,将计算机编程技能与机械加工过程相结合,为创新的制造工业做出贡献。


一、数控编程的学科背景

数控编程是现代制造业的核心技术之一,它将计算机科学的原理与机械制造的实践相结合。在大学教育中,数控编程主要集中在以下几个相关学科:

二、机械工程与自动化

在机械工程与自动化专业中,数控编程占据了重要的地位。此学科教授学生如何设计机械系统,同时也着重于制造过程的自动化。数控机床的编程和操作成为学生必修的课程。在这一领域,学生将学习如何将设计图纸转化为具体的编程代码,这些代码能够指挥数控机床精确地加工出设计好的零件。此类技能的掌握为提高生产效率和产品质量提供了重要保障。

三、电子工程专业

在电子工程专业领域,数控编程也发挥着重要作用。学生在学习电子设备设计和制造的过程中,需要掌握如何使用数控设备来制造复杂的电子部件。在这一专业中,数控编程与电子工程的其他知识点结合紧密,要求学生具备跨学科的思维能力。

四、计算机科学与技术

计算机科学与技术专业的学生同样需要掌握数控编程的知识。尽管该专业更注重软件开发和信息技术,但为了满足制造业中数控设备和机器人编程的需求,该学科也提供了相关课程。编程语言的理解、编程逻辑的建立以及对数控系统的控制是该专业学生必须掌握的技能,这些能力对于开发能高效管理制造过程的软件系统至关重要。


五、数控编程的专业知识和技能

数控编程不仅仅是编写代码那么简单,它涉及到一系列复杂的专业知识和技能。专业从业者需要具备以下几项能力:

六、CAD/CAM技能

计算机辅助设计(CAD)和计算机辅助制造(CAM) 是数控编程中不可或缺的技能。CAD使设计师能够使用计算机技术来创建详细的设计图纸,而CAM则是将这些图纸转化为数控机床能读懂的编程语言。掌握这些软件工具能够大幅提高设计到生产的效率。

七、数控机床操作

数控编程专家不仅要能编写程序,还需要熟练操作各类数控机床。这包括对设备的日常维护、故障诊断以及性能优化等。了解机床的工作原理和维护要求是提高生产稳定性的关键。

八、材料学和加工工艺

对于不同的材料,数控编程过程会有所不同。因此,深入理解各种材料的特性及适合的加工工艺对于编写有效的数控程序至关重要。高级数控编程涉及对切削速度、进给速率和切削深度等参数的精确控制,以适应特定材料的加工要求。

九、质量控制与测试

为了确保加工件的精度和质量,编程过程中需要考虑质量控制的要素。数控编程专家必须了解如何设置检测点并运用适当的测试方法来检验成品质量。这一环节保证了产品可以满足严格的工业标准和客户要求。


数控编程是一个高度综合的领域,它结合了多个学科的知识。随着工业4.0的到来,数控编程变得更加重要,因为它涉及到智能制造和自动化的核心。未来的工程师不仅要学会如何编程,还要理解机械加工的本质,才能在这个快速发展的领域中保持领先。

相关问答FAQs:

数控编程是一门涉及机械工业的技术,并不是以大学划分的。数控编程是数控技术的一部分,它与机械制造、自动控制、计算机科学等领域有关。因此,在大学中,数控编程通常属于机械工程、制造工程、自动化工程、计算机科学与技术等相关专业。

  • 机械工程专业:数控编程在机械工程专业中是一个重要的课程,学生将学习数控机床的原理、编程技术以及数控操作等知识。他们将学习如何使用计算机辅助设计(CAD)软件来创建三维模型,并使用计算机辅助制造(CAM)软件将模型转化为数控编程代码,以实现自动化加工。

  • 制造工程专业:在制造工程专业中,学生将学习各种加工工艺和生产技术,包括数控编程。他们将研究如何利用数控机床来生产各种复杂工件,并通过编程实现高效的加工过程。数控编程在制造工程中扮演着至关重要的角色。

  • 计算机科学与技术专业:数控编程涉及到计算机科学与技术领域的知识,包括编程语言、算法设计等。在计算机科学与技术专业中,学生将学习如何编写数控程序,并掌握数控机床的控制和操作。他们将研究如何通过编程实现高效的自动化加工过程。

总的来说,数控编程属于机械工程、制造工程和计算机科学与技术等相关专业。但它更多地是一门跨学科的技术,涉及到机械工业、自动化控制和计算机科学等多个领域的知识。对于有兴趣从事机械制造和自动化领域工作的学生来说,学习数控编程将是非常有用的。

文章标题:数控编程属于什么大学,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1584204

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 如何在百度搜索引擎中进行优化

    在百度搜索引擎中进行优化的步骤:1、选择合适的关键词;2、提升关键词密度;3、优化页面标题和描述;4、优化内部链接;5、建立外部链接;6、提供有价值的内容;7、优化页面加载速度;8、使用语义化标签;9、移动端优化;10、定期更新内容;11、监控竞争对手的SEO策略;12、与用户建立良好的关系。

    2023年11月11日
    41100
  • 养殖业项目如何管理好客户

    养殖业项目管理好客户的关键在于:建立完善的客户信息数据库、了解客户需求、提供优质的服务与产品、维护长期的客户关系、以及有效的客户反馈系统。 其中,建立一个完善的客户信息数据库是基础。通过这一数据库,企业不仅可以存储客户的基本信息,还能记录客户的购买历史和偏好,分析这些数据可以帮助企业更好地了解目标市…

    2024年4月11日
    6500
  • 标准编程语法是什么专业

    标准编程语法是计算机科学与技术专业的核心组成部分之一。在这个专业中,学习标准编程语法不仅仅意味着掌握各种编程语言的书写规则,而且涉及到了深刻理解语言设计的原理、开发高效可靠软件的方法以及维持代码质量的最佳实践。特别是对于初学者来说,通过系统学习和实践标准编程语法,可以极大提高编程能力,增进对软件开发…

    2024年5月7日
    1000
  • 拖动编程是什么

    拖动编程是一种可视化编程方法,它允许用户通过拖放图形化的代码块来创建程序,而无需写任何传统的代码文本。这种方法主要目的是简化编程学习过程,使得无论年龄或专业背景,人们都能够易于上手并理解编程的基本概念。1、提高编程入门的易性是拖动编程的核心优势之一。它通过直观的界面降低了编程的入门门槛,特别是对于儿…

    2024年5月2日
    2100
  • 编程什么是递归

    递归是一种在编程中常用的解决问题的方法,它通过函数自己调用自己来重复解决子问题。递归可以分为两个主要部分:基线条件(递归结束的条件)和递归步骤(函数自我调用)。 描述递归的运作机制,基线条件是递归过程中的停止信号。没有基线条件,递归会无限进行下去,导致栈溢出错误。例如,在计算阶乘时,基线条件通常是当…

    2024年5月2日
    2500
  • 如何提高团队的进度管理能力

    在工程项目管理中,提升团队进度管理能力至关重要。这包括1、精准的时间规划、2、高效的任务分配、3、持续的进度监控与4、灵活的进度调整。在这些要素中,提高精准时间规划尤为关键,因为它确保了项目按预定目标推进,防止了时间资源的浪费。 对于精准的时间规划而言,必须依赖于细致的项目计划。首要任务是定义项目范…

    2023年12月26日
    27600
  • 什么是魅力编程软件

    魅力编程软件是一种将编程概念和操作封装成具有吸引力的界面和功能,1、便于学习和使用,2、激发兴趣和创造力的工具。其中,便于学习和使用指的是这类软件设计着重于降低编程入门的难度,通过直观的操作界面、丰富的示例和引导,使得初学者能够快速上手,体验编程的乐趣,从而培养对编程的兴趣。 I、引入 在数字化时代…

    2024年5月2日
    2900
  • win编程是什么

    WIN编程指的是在Windows操作系统下进行的编程,主要涉及使用Windows API、框架和开发环境来创建应用程序。1、Windows API的直接调用是其显著特点之一。Windows API为程序员提供了一个底层编程接口,通过它可以直接与Windows操作系统交互,实现对系统资源的管理和应用程…

    2024年5月2日
    3100
  • 编程基于什么平台

    编程主要基于操作系统、综合开发环境、编程语言和框架。操作系统如Windows、macOS或Linux,为软件提供运行环境。开发环境,比如Visual Studio或Eclipse,支持代码编写、调试与管理。编程语言,像Python、Java或C++,则是构建程序的基本工具。框架,例如Angular、…

    2024年5月2日
    3300
  • devops有什么好处

    摘要:DevOps的优势不仅在于其促进快速、高效的软件开发与交付,它还极大地增强了跨团队协作、提升了产品质量、并显著提高了客户满意度。1、加速交付时间促进业务成长,2、提高协作效率营建团队和谐,3、加强产品稳定性保障用户体验。尤其值得强调的是,提高协作效率营建团队和谐这一点,通过自动化流程与持续集成…

    2024年3月26日
    10700

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部